In Georgia, it is estimated that more than 60% of drug overdose deaths are going to occur from opioids of some kind. The damage is also predicted to get worse and continue into the future. While prescription opioid deaths and synthetic opioid deaths decreased in the state of Georgia, the opposite is true for those using heroin.

Heroin continues to be a big problem in the state of Georgia, causing a lot of issues for individuals who decide to partake in this kind of substance. And with it being found in mixtures of street drugs and other locations, it is becoming easier for someone to fall into an addiction and go into an overdose at the same time. Choosing a heroin addiction treatment center in Georgia is one of the best ways to deal with the problems that come with a heroin addiction before it results in death.

Heroin Detox in Georgia

The patient will first need to go through a heroin detox when they enter into heroin addiction treatment in Georgia. This detox process will help to remove the heroin from the body and allows for the rest of the time in treatment to be more effective than if the substance were still in the body.

The patient will be under the direct supervision of medical professionals as they work through the heroin detox. This allows the medical team to monitor the patient, checking whether there are issues that pop up during the withdrawal period. Most patients can expect to be uncomfortable during the detox as the body adjusts to surviving without the addictive substance. However, it is not uncommon for some patients to have severe withdrawal symptoms, some of which can be severe,

The medical team may also decide that it is best for the patient to undergo a tapering process to help with the addiction and withdrawal. Sometimes the use of methadone is encouraged for some of the more severe addictions, limiting some of the risks that withdrawal can have on the patient as well.

Treatment Duration

Treatment duration will depend on the patient and how much help they need with their current addiction. If the patient has a severe addiction to heroin, they will need to choose a heroin rehab center that allows for up to 90 days. If the patient is not able to be away from their home for longer than a few weeks or who have a less severe addiction can get away with going for 30 days.

Most treatment facilities for heroin addiction will last between 30 to 90 days. These provide enough time for the patient to go through treatment and handle some of the issues with their addiction, while also going through the detox in the beginning. If possible, the patient should consider going to treatment for 90-days to provide the best benefits for them.

Cost of Treatment

The cost of treatment in Georgia is considered affordable compared to some of the other states in the country. It is possible to attend a heroin addiction treatment in Georgia for $7000 to $8000 a month. The amount of time that you spend at the facility, the amenities found at the facility, and other features will help you determine what the overall costs of that facility will be.

If the patient chooses to go with a luxurious heroin addiction rehab, they will need to expect to pay more for their time there. This can often go as high as $30,000 a month to get all of the extra amenities that they want at the facility. There are also lower-cost options that are closer to $3000 to $4000 a month to make this more affordable.
